Digital Marketing Mastery: The Foundation

Before you can master the niche of influencer management, you must have a rock-solid understanding of the broader digital marketing ecosystem. Influencer campaigns do not exist in a vacuum; they are integrated components of a larger marketing strategy. Pursuing a certification like the Google Digital Marketing & E-commerce Professional Certificate or the Meta Certified Digital Marketing Associate is non-negotiable. These programs provide a deep dive into the principles of SEO, SEM, email marketing, and social media advertising. For a remote influencer manager, this knowledge is power. It allows you to speak the same language as your clients’ marketing directors and to position your influencer campaigns as a strategic complement to their paid ad spend. For example, understanding how to use UTM parameters to track influencer-driven website traffic, or how to analyze the overlap between an influencer’s audience and a brand’s custom Facebook audience, transforms you from a broker of posts into a data-driven strategist. This foundational knowledge ensures that the campaigns you manage remotely are measurable, scalable, and directly tied to business objectives.

Specialized Influencer Strategy and Analytics

This is where you move from a generalist to a specialist. Certifications in this category are laser-focused on the mechanics of successful influencer partnerships. The Influencer Marketing Certificate from the Digital Marketing Institute (DMI) is a prime example, covering everything from campaign planning and creator selection to legal compliance and performance analysis. Another formidable option is the training offered by platforms like Traackr or AspireIQ, which certify you in using their analytics tools to identify fake followers, measure true engagement rates, and calculate earned media value. For a remote manager, these platform-specific certifications are incredibly valuable. They prove you can leverage enterprise-grade technology to manage relationships and report on success without ever needing to be in a physical office. Imagine presenting a client with a dashboard that not only shows likes and comments but also tracks sentiment analysis, share of voice against competitors, and the cost per engagement compared to other marketing channels. This level of analytical rigor is what justifies retainers and builds long-term client relationships in a remote work environment.

Project Management Excellence for Remote Teams

Remote influencer management is, at its core, a complex project management role. You are simultaneously managing multiple influencers, each with their own deliverables, deadlines, and personalities, while also acting as the main point of contact for the client. A certification in project management is not a nice-to-have; it’s a career accelerator. The Certified Associate in Project Management (CAPM) from the Project Management Institute (PMI) provides a globally recognized framework for initiating, planning, executing, and closing projects. This skillset translates directly into managing an influencer campaign. You’ll learn to create detailed scope documents to prevent “scope creep,” develop realistic timelines using Gantt charts, manage budgets effectively, and implement risk mitigation strategies. For instance, what is your contingency plan if an influencer’s content is rejected the day before the go-live date? A certified project manager has a process for this, ensuring that remote workflows remain smooth and professional even under pressure. This certification equips you with the tools to be the organized, reliable anchor that both brands and influencers can depend on.

Choosing the Right Certification Path for You

With so many options, selecting the right certification requires introspection and strategy. Begin by conducting a candid skills audit. Are you strong on creative strategy but weak on reading analytics? Then a data-focused certification from a platform like Traackr might be your first step. Are you struggling to keep 20 different influencer threads organized? The CAPM could be your game-changer. Next, consider your career trajectory. If you aim to work with large global brands, a certification from a well-known institution like the DMI or PMI carries significant weight. If you plan to specialize in a specific vertical like beauty or gaming, look for niche courses offered by industry-specific consulting firms or networks. Finally, evaluate the practicalities: cost, time commitment, and format. Many top-tier certifications are now available entirely online, which is perfect for a remote professional. Remember, this is an investment in your credibility and skill set, one that allows you to command higher rates and secure more prestigious, remote-friendly positions.
